Although Giggsy would go on to become one of Wales' most famous love rats, early on his romantic life there were signs he would be the perfect family man.
In 2007, Giggs married childhood sweetheart Stacey Cooke at a small ceremony in Manchester's Lowry Hotel.
The pair would go on to have two children together, with the youngest Zach now a promising footballer at the age of 17.
The happy family moved into a £3million mansion in Worsley, Greater Manchester together and seemed set up for marital bliss, but there were storms on the horizon, including one gale from the most unexpected of places.
Growing up, brothers are often forced to share everything from clothes to food but Giggs took it one step further with his brother Rhodri's most prized asset.
In 2011 it came to light that Giggs had been having an eight-year- affair with Rhodri's wife Natasha whilst he was married Stacey.
